The End Alcohol Advertising in Sport campaign calls for alcohol advertising to be phased out of professional sports. This is an initiative by the Foundation for Alcohol Research and Education, supported by health organisations across Australia.
“Millions of Australian children and families watch the AFL, NRL, and cricket; sports which are saturated with alcohol advertising. So much so that it’s becoming impossible to know where the game ends and the alcohol marketing begins.
Yet all the evidence shows that exposure to alcohol advertising is associated with young people drinking more and from an earlier age.
That’s why we’re calling for an end to alcohol advertising in sport. Let’s protect our kids by removing alcohol brands from Australia’s favourite games.”
